I think doing a cut on the A hole right as i tongue a low d is the easiest way to consistently get it without breaking the note.
Or if I’m ascending down from E sometimes I don’t tongue the D and just finger it while letting my breath taper off

I thought the same thing for several weeks when I started playing until I learned to dam up the hollow spot where the fipple should be in the mouthpiece with blu tac. Then when I got a moderately better whistle than the cheapos I started with (a Walton’s, a Clarke sweet tone, and a generation) I found I have absolutely no issues getting high notes. Even the 3rd octave D is fairly easy with a decent whistle. And by decent I mean one that’s around 20-30 quid
